Landing team 16.03.16

 

Hello everyone,

Today's landing news: we're getting closer and closer to OTA-10. We had
a new pay-service (merging in the pay-ui bits into the debian package),
location-service, a new ubuntu-system-settings (adding the VPN panel to
the UI, finalizations of the new VPN feature), a new hybris, bugfix for
webbrowser-app (for webapps), new indicator-datetime and
qtorganizer5-eds. Since we're in feature freeze, all landings now
besides a few singular exceptions are basically bugfixes.

Those using rc-proposed and upgrading in the morning might have noticed
a few of their apps uninstalled. This was caused by a bug that we're now
tracking [1] which is only happening in rare cases when we remove
default apps from our rc-proposed image builds. We apologise for the
inconvenience but remember: things like this are bound to happen in
rc-proposed, which is why we generally do not recommend using this
channel for everyday users.

Another bit of potentially interesting info for some. We now use a
special click-lock mechanism for staging clicks on rc-proposed images
that depend on unreleased frameworks. Due to the current click
limitations, we cannot publish new click packages if the dependent
framework is not yet released in a stable image. We now make this work
through staging such clicks in rc-proposed, meaning some images might
have click package versions installed that are not available in the
store yet. Please note this is not a very common case, so do not switch
to this channel unnecessarily just to get the latest bits. But for
dogfooding purposes for developers - it's a good thing.
